How much do remote react native j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 4, 2026, the average hourly pay for remote react native in Missouri is $51.60,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$38.80 and $62.21 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a remote React Native?

A Remote React Native job involves developing mobile applications using the React Native framework while working from a remote location. Developers in this role build cross-platform apps for iOS and Android using JavaScript and React. Responsibilities typically include writing clean code, debugging issues, and collaborating with teams through online communication tools. Remote React Native developers need strong problem-solving skills and familiarity with mobile app development best practices.

What does a typical day look like for a remote React Native developer?

A typical day for a Remote React Native developer involves writing and testing code for mobile apps, collaborating with designers and backend developers through online meetings or chat tools, and participating in code reviews or daily stand-ups. Most developers spend significant time problem-solving and implementing new features or fixing bugs while keeping up to date with best practices in mobile development. Communication is primarily online, requiring clear documentation and regular updates to the team. You’ll also coordinate closely with project managers or stakeholders to clarify requirements and ensure project milestones are met.

This position is listed on behalf of a partner company, who manages all applications and next steps. Our partner is looking for a Senior Software Engineer, Agents based in Netherlands.

As a Senior Software Engineer specializing in AI agents, you will help build the next generation of intelligent developer tools designed to simplify complex technical workflows and deliver actionable insights. You will create the foundational infrastructure behind AI-powered assistants, including orchestration systems, tool execution frameworks, context management, evaluation pipelines, and reliability layers. Working in a remote-first engineering environment, you will have the opportunity to shape an emerging AI product from an early stage while solving challenging backend and machine learning problems. This role is ideal for an engineer who enjoys ambiguity, takes ownership, and wants to build systems that can scale to support thousands of users and complex real-world interactions.

Accountabilities
  • Design and build the core infrastructure powering AI agent capabilities, including orchestration, tool execution, context management, evaluation systems, and trust frameworks.
  • Develop reliable, secure, and observable backend systems that enable AI assistants to interact with data, applications, and developer workflows.
  • Create and improve agent-based features that help users analyze information, understand performance, troubleshoot issues, and make better decisions.
  • Build systems around large language models, including tool usage, structured outputs, context handling, evaluation processes, and agent workflows.
  • Collaborate with engineering teams to define architecture, identify technical challenges, and establish scalable solutions for an evolving AI platform.
  • Improve system reliability, performance, and usability by identifying gaps, investigating issues, and implementing meaningful improvements.
  • Contribute to technical discussions, code reviews, architecture decisions, and engineering best practices.
  • Take ownership of projects from concept to delivery while working independently in a fast-moving product environment.
  • Support knowledge sharing and mentor other engineers as the team and platform continue to grow.
Requirements
  • 5+ years of experience building and shipping production software systems.
  • Hands-on experience developing applications with large language models, beyond basic prompting, including agent workflows, tool integration, structured outputs, context management, orchestration, or evaluation.
  • Strong backend engineering fundamentals with experience designing reliable, scalable, secure, and observable systems.
  • Ability to work effectively in ambiguous environments where architecture and product direction are continuously evolving.
  • Self-driven approach with the ability to identify opportunities, define solutions, and deliver projects independently.
  • Strong communication and collaboration skills, especially within remote and distributed engineering teams.
  • Experience with AI platforms and tools such as OpenAI or Anthropic APIs is a plus.
  • Previous experience building AI agents, conversational interfaces, Slack integrations, or developer-focused tools is advantageous.
  • Familiarity with evaluation and observability frameworks such as Langfuse or LangChain is a plus.
  • Knowledge of subscription business models, mobile applications, app stores, or developer platforms is beneficial.
  • Contributions to open-source AI or machine learning projects are considered an advantage.
